Kindness Is Contagious

There are only two things we are here on earth to do and everything else in the gospel is related to one of those.

1. Love God, turn to Him often, come to know Him, and
2. Love each other and take care of one another.

That's what visiting teaching is about. That's what we covenant to do when we are baptized (share one another's burden) and that's what our Savior taught us by his example.

And sometimes a kind word, a listening ear, or a smile is all that is needed.

A small act at the grocery store starts a new ripple
There are two men who are almost always outside my grocery store, in various states of dishevelment.

...Last week, while waiting in the deli area, I noticed the pre-made, plastic-wrapped sub-style sandwiches. I grabbed two of them, two extra apples, and two single-serving juice bottles. On my way out, I walked up to the vet and said, "Are you hungry? I got you a sandwich." He took sandwich, apple, and juice, and said, "God bless you." I said, "You, too!"

...It was so easy to  add those few items to my grocery bag and I felt like I had maybe helped just a little.
